package com.salesforceiq.augmenteddriver.util;
import com.google.common.base.Preconditions;
import io.appium.java_client.AppiumDriver;
import org.openqa.selenium.By;
import org.openqa.selenium.Dimension;
import org.openqa.selenium.WebElement;
/**
* Common utilities for IOS and Android.
*/
public class MobileUtil {
private static final int VERTICAL_OFFSET = 10;
private static final int BIG_NUMBER = 9999999;
/**
* Taps on a location determined by the coordinated of the element plus the offsets.
*
* @param driver The AppiumDriver used to tap.
* @param augmentedFunctions all the augmented functions.
* @param by the by that identifies the element
* @param offsetX horizontal offset (can be negative) where the tap will occur from the element
* @param offsetY vertical offset (can be negative) where the tap will occur from the element.
* @param waitTimeInSeconds how much time to wait until the element becomes visible
* @param pressInMilliSeconds how much time to press the element before swiping.
* @param fingers how many fingers to press.
* @return the element that was used to determine the coordinates.
*/
public static WebElement tapAfter(AppiumDriver driver, AugmentedFunctions augmentedFunctions,
By by, int offsetX, int offsetY, int waitTimeInSeconds, int pressInMilliSeconds, int fingers) {
Preconditions.checkNotNull(driver);
Preconditions.checkNotNull(augmentedFunctions);
Preconditions.checkNotNull(by);
WebElement element = augmentedFunctions.findElementPresentAfter(by, waitTimeInSeconds);
driver.tap(fingers, element.getLocation().getX() + offsetX, element.getLocation().getY() + offsetY, pressInMilliSeconds);
return element;
}
/**
* Swipes up on an element, until the other element becomes visible.
*
* @param driver The AppiumDriver used to swipe up.
* @param augmentedFunctions all the augmented functions.
* @param swipeElement form which element the swipe up should start
* @param elementVisible which element should become visible
* @param pressInMilliSeconds how much time to press the element before swiping.
* @param waitTimeInSeconds how much time to wait until the element becomes visible
* @param quantity how many times should you swipe before giving up.
* @return the element visible.
*/
public static WebElement swipeUpWaitVisibleAfter(AppiumDriver driver,
AugmentedFunctions augmentedFunctions,
By swipeElement,
By elementVisible,
int waitTimeInSeconds,
int quantity,
int pressInMilliSeconds) {
Preconditions.checkNotNull(driver);
Preconditions.checkNotNull(augmentedFunctions);
Preconditions.checkNotNull(swipeElement);
Preconditions.checkNotNull(elementVisible);
return swipeVerticalWaitVisibleAfter(driver, augmentedFunctions, swipeElement,
elementVisible, waitTimeInSeconds, -BIG_NUMBER, quantity, pressInMilliSeconds);
}
/**
* Swipes down on an element, until the other element becomes visible.
*
* @param driver The AppiumDriver used to swipe down.
* @param augmentedFunctions all the augmented functions.
* @param swipeElement form which element the swipe up should start
* @param elementVisible which element should become visible
* @param pressInMilliSeconds how much time to press the element before swiping.
* @param quantity how many times should you swipe before giving up.
* @param waitTimeInSeconds how much time to wait until the element becomes visible
* @return the element visible.
*/
public static WebElement swipeDownWaitVisible(AppiumDriver driver,
AugmentedFunctions augmentedFunctions,
By swipeElement,
By elementVisible,
int waitTimeInSeconds,
int quantity,
int pressInMilliSeconds) {
Preconditions.checkNotNull(driver);
Preconditions.checkNotNull(augmentedFunctions);
Preconditions.checkNotNull(swipeElement);
Preconditions.checkNotNull(elementVisible);
return swipeVerticalWaitVisibleAfter(driver, augmentedFunctions, swipeElement,
elementVisible, waitTimeInSeconds, BIG_NUMBER, quantity, pressInMilliSeconds);
}
/**
* Swipes up on an element, pressing a default amount of time before swiping.
*
* @param driver The AppiumDriver used to swipe Up.
* @param augmentedFunctions all the augmented functions.
* @param swipeBy from which element the swipe up should start.
* @param waitTimeInSeconds how much time to wait until the element becomes visible
* @param pressInMilliSeconds how much time to press the element before swiping.
*/
public static void swipeUpAfter(AppiumDriver driver,
AugmentedFunctions augmentedFunctions,
By swipeBy,
int waitTimeInSeconds,
int pressInMilliSeconds) {
Preconditions.checkNotNull(driver);
Preconditions.checkNotNull(augmentedFunctions);
Preconditions.checkNotNull(swipeBy);
swipeVerticalAfter(driver, augmentedFunctions, swipeBy, waitTimeInSeconds, -BIG_NUMBER, pressInMilliSeconds);
}
/**
* Swipes down on an element, pressing a default amount of time before swiping.
*
* @param driver The AppiumDriver used to swipe Up.
* @param augmentedFunctions all the augmented functions.
* @param swipeBy from which element the swipe down should start.
* @param waitTimeInSeconds how much time to wait until the element becomes visible
* @param pressInMilliSeconds how much time to press the element before swiping.
*/
public static void swipeDownAfter(AppiumDriver driver,
AugmentedFunctions augmentedFunctions,
By swipeBy,
int waitTimeInSeconds,
int pressInMilliSeconds) {
Preconditions.checkNotNull(driver);
Preconditions.checkNotNull(augmentedFunctions);
Preconditions.checkNotNull(swipeBy);
swipeVerticalAfter(driver, augmentedFunctions, swipeBy, waitTimeInSeconds, BIG_NUMBER, pressInMilliSeconds);
}
/**
* Swipes vertical (depends on the offset if negative or positive) on an element, pressing
* for a specific duration before swiping.
*
* @param driver The AppiumDriver used to swipe Up.
* @param augmentedFunctions all the augmented functions.
* @param swipeBy from which element the swipe should start.
* @param offset The offset where to end the swipe.
* @param waitTimeInSeconds how much time to wait until the element becomes visible
* @param durationInMilliSeconds time to press before swiping.
*/
public static void swipeVerticalAfter(AppiumDriver driver,
AugmentedFunctions augmentedFunctions,
By swipeBy,
int waitTimeInSeconds,
int offset,
int durationInMilliSeconds) {
Preconditions.checkNotNull(driver);
Preconditions.checkNotNull(augmentedFunctions);
Preconditions.checkNotNull(swipeBy);
WebElement elementPresent = augmentedFunctions.findElementPresentAfter(swipeBy, waitTimeInSeconds);
int x = elementPresent.getLocation().getX() + elementPresent.getSize().getWidth() / 2;
int y = elementPresent.getLocation().getY() + elementPresent.getSize().getHeight() / 2;
int swipe = getVerticalOffset(driver, y, offset);
driver.swipe(x, y, x, swipe, durationInMilliSeconds);
}
/**
* Swipes vertical on an element until another becomes visible. How much to swipe depends on the
* offset, and how much time to press before swiping depends on durationInMilliSeconds.
*
* Finally quantity is the amount of times it will swipe before giving up and failing since the
* element did not show up.
*
* @param driver The AppiumDriver used to swipe.
* @param augmentedFunctions all the augmented functions.
* @param swipeElement from which element the swipe should start.
* @param elementVisible which element has to become visibile.
* @param waitTimeInSeconds how much time to wait until the element becomes visible
* @param offset The offset where to end the swipe.
* @param durationInMilliSeconds time to press before swiping.
* @param quantity how many time to try swiping.
* @return the element that became visible.
*/
public static WebElement swipeVerticalWaitVisibleAfter(AppiumDriver driver,
AugmentedFunctions augmentedFunctions,
By swipeElement,
By elementVisible,
int waitTimeInSeconds,
int offset,
int quantity,
int durationInMilliSeconds) {
Preconditions.checkNotNull(driver);
Preconditions.checkNotNull(augmentedFunctions);
Preconditions.checkNotNull(swipeElement);
Preconditions.checkNotNull(elementVisible);
WebElement elementPresent = augmentedFunctions.findElementPresentAfter(swipeElement, waitTimeInSeconds);
int x = elementPresent.getLocation().getX() + elementPresent.getSize().getWidth() / 2;
int y = elementPresent.getLocation().getY() + elementPresent.getSize().getHeight() / 2;
int swipe = getVerticalOffset(driver, y, offset);
for(int iteration = 0; iteration < quantity; iteration++) {
driver.swipe(x, y, x, swipe, durationInMilliSeconds);
if (augmentedFunctions.isElementVisibleAfter(elementVisible, 3)) {
return augmentedFunctions.findElementVisible(elementVisible);
}
}
throw new AssertionError(String.format("Swiped %s with an offest of %s times but element %s not found",
quantity, offset, elementVisible));
}
/**
* Swipes right from the left of the screen to the right of the screen on the vertical alignment of an
* element.
*
* @param driver The AppiumDriver used to swipe.
* @param augmentedFunctions all the augmented functions.
* @param by the element to find the vertical coordinates
* @param waitTimeInSeconds how much time to wait until the element becomes present.
* @param pressInMilliSeconds Time to press the element before swiping.
*/
public static void swipeFullRightAfter(AppiumDriver driver, AugmentedFunctions augmentedFunctions, By by,
int waitTimeInSeconds, int pressInMilliSeconds) {
Preconditions.checkNotNull(driver);
Preconditions.checkNotNull(augmentedFunctions);
Preconditions.checkNotNull(by);
WebElement element = augmentedFunctions.findElementPresentAfter(by, waitTimeInSeconds);
Dimension size = driver.manage().window().getSize();
int to = size.getWidth() * 85 / 100;
int from = size.getWidth() * 15 / 100;
int y = element.getLocation().getY() + element.getSize().getHeight() / 2;
driver.swipe(from, y, to, y, pressInMilliSeconds);
}
/**
* Swipes left from the right of the screen to the left of the screen on the vertical alignment of an
* element.
*
* @param driver The AppiumDriver used to swipe.
* @param augmentedFunctions all the augmented functions.
* @param by the element to find the vertical coordinates
* @param waitTimeInSeconds how much time to wait until the element becomes present.
* @param pressInMilliSeconds Time to press the element before swiping.
*/
public static void swipeFullLeftAfter(AppiumDriver driver, AugmentedFunctions augmentedFunctions, By by,
int waitTimeInSeconds, int pressInMilliSeconds) {
Preconditions.checkNotNull(by);
Preconditions.checkNotNull(driver);
Preconditions.checkNotNull(augmentedFunctions);
WebElement element = augmentedFunctions.findElementPresentAfter(by, waitTimeInSeconds);
Dimension size = driver.manage().window().getSize();
int from = size.getWidth() * 85 / 100;
int to = size.getWidth() * 15 / 100;
int y = element.getLocation().getY() + element.getSize().getHeight() / 2;
driver.swipe(from, y, to, y, pressInMilliSeconds);
}
/**
* Basically its caps how close you can get swiping to the vertical borders of the device
*
* @param driver The AppiumDriver used to swipe.
* @param y the actual vertical position.
* @param offset how much you want to swipe from the vertical position.
* @return the end coordinate of the swiping action.
*/
private static int getVerticalOffset(AppiumDriver driver, int y, int offset) {
Preconditions.checkNotNull(driver);
if (y + offset < VERTICAL_OFFSET) {
return VERTICAL_OFFSET;
} else if (y + offset > driver.manage().window().getSize().getHeight() - VERTICAL_OFFSET) {
return driver.manage().window().getSize().getHeight() - VERTICAL_OFFSET;
} else {
return y + offset;
}
}
}
